Table I.A.2.b(2013) Percent of private-sector establishments that offer health insurance that offer at least one health insurance plan that required no contribution from the employee for single coverage by firm size and selected characteristics: United States, 2013
Characteristics Total Less than 10 employees 10-24 employees 25-99 employees 100-999 employees 1000 or more employees Less than 50 employees 50 or more employees
United States 32.8%    61.8%    43.1%    28.9%    13.2%    5.6%    53.7%    9.7%   
Industry group **
Agric., fish., forest. 69.3%    74.6%    76.9%    60.1%    --    --    74.5%    39.3%   
Mining and manufacturing 31.3%    59.2%    33.4%    22.6%    --    --    44.1%    11.7%   
Construction 50.6%    59.9%    43.7%    44.3%    --    --    54.4%    27.0%   
Utilities and transp. 32.2%    54.4%    48.2%    28.4% * --    --    51.1%    18.3%   
Wholesale trade 37.0%    68.4%    43.0%    31.7%    --    --    57.6%    8.6%   
Fin. svs. and real estate 27.9%    62.3%    44.9%    34.7%    --    --    56.6%    11.2%   
Retail trade 19.1%    59.4%    40.9%    18.5%    --    --    50.0%    4.2%   
Professional services 38.3%    61.6%    43.7%    29.2%    --    --    54.0%    11.8%   
Other services 32.9%    61.2%    44.1%    26.1%    --    --    53.0%    9.2%   
Ownership
For profit, incorporated 31.0%    61.5%    42.5%    28.7%    --    --    52.9%    9.1%   
For profit, unincorporated 37.1%    61.1%    41.5%    22.2%    --    --    54.4%    7.0%   
Nonprofit 38.9%    65.5%    49.0%    37.4%    --    --    57.8%    18.3%   
Age of firm
Less than 5 years 45.9%    51.6%    37.9%    31.8%    --    --    48.5%    13.7%   
5-9 years 46.3%    58.9%    36.0%    22.5%    --    --    50.6%    16.4%   
10-19 years 46.7%    63.8%    44.6%    30.5%    --    --    56.1%    13.8%   
20 or more years 25.2%    66.6%    45.5%    29.3%    --    --    55.3%    9.1%   
Multi/single status
2 or more locations 11.5%    63.5%    42.4%    28.8%    --    --    42.7%    8.4%   
1 location only 52.2%    61.7%    43.2%    29.0%    --    --    54.6%    23.5%   
Percent full-time employees
Less than 25% 23.9%    49.2%    34.9%    26.4%    --    --    44.2%    9.1%   
25-49 % 23.6%    55.8%    49.1%    26.9%    --    --    49.0%    5.8%   
50-74 % 28.8%    62.2%    43.0%    22.0%    --    --    53.5%    6.6%   
75% or more 35.4%    62.9%    43.0%    30.5%    --    --    54.7%    11.2%   
Union presence
No union employees 36.8%    61.5%    42.5%    27.8%    --    --    53.3%    10.4%   
Has union employees 20.3%    69.9%    57.0%    47.7%    --    --    64.7%    10.2%   
Unknown 8.9%    66.2%    56.4%    24.0% * --    --    53.1%    6.9%   
Percent low wage employees
50% or more low wage 22.3%    62.6%    39.5%    20.6%    --    --    51.3%    6.7%   
Less than 50% low wage 36.3%    61.6%    43.7%    31.3%    --    --    54.1%    11.3%   

Source: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ality, Center for Financing, Access and Cost Trends. 2013 Medical Expenditure Panel Survey-Insurance Component.

Note: Definitions and descriptions of the methods used for this survey can be found in the Technical Appendix.

* Figure does not meet standard of reliability or precision.

-- Data suppressed due to high standard errors or no reported values in cell.

** Definitions of industry groups and low-wage employees changed in 2000. These data are not comparable to IC data prior to 2000. See Technical Appendix.
